Transaction 8d1970adcffeb552fb6743a2ffaac1b805f122bd886d61c47317310b698a68bf

52 Input
2 Outputs
  • 8d1970adcffeb552fb6743a2ffaac1b805f122bd886d61c47317310b698a68bf:0
  • value  910033
    address  37X56LdfyHMTE2oLtsUvq3Rm8TU3hsz939
  • 8d1970adcffeb552fb6743a2ffaac1b805f122bd886d61c47317310b698a68bf:1
  • value  394691002
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s